There are no items in your cart
Add More
Add More
Item Details | Price |
---|
star star star star star | 5.0 (194 ratings) |
Instructor: Expert WsCube Tech Team
Language: Bilingual (Hindi + English)
Validity Period: Lifetime
We built this curriculum for aspiring Android developers who are new to programming to ensure that you get the real-world skills you need to know how to build and accelerate your journey towards becoming a professional Android Developer.
By the end of the course, you’ll know how to publish your own app to the Google Play Store, where you can reach and engage users across the globe.
Entering students should be motivated to learn and be comfortable with basic computer skills like managing files, navigating the Internet and running programs.
We will use Android Studio to build our apps, so you should have access to a computer that can run Android Studio in order to follow along. Don’t worry, you do not need to install Android Studio in advance -- we will provide detailed installation instructions as part of the course.
Your ENTHUSIASM to learn the world's No 1 app development framework.
Introduction & Environment Setup | |||
Introduction to Android | Preview | ||
History of Android 17:00 | |||
Introduction to Android Quiz 1 | |||
Versions/Flavors of Android 28:00 | |||
What is IDE? 8:00 | |||
Introduction to Android Quiz 2 | |||
Setting Up Android Studio on System (Windows) 25:00 | Preview | ||
Setting Up Android Studio on System (macOS) 9:00 | |||
Setting Up Android Studio on System (Linux) 12:00 | |||
Front End and Back End Languages (Java/Kotlin, XML) 14:00 | |||
Running App Process (ADB & AVD) 8:00 | |||
The Extension .apk 3:00 | |||
Introduction to Android Quiz 3 | |||
Assignment (1 pages) | |||
Introduction & Environment Setup Notes (13 pages) | |||
Knowing the Development Process | |||
Creating First Android Studio Project 45:00 | Preview | ||
Knowing the Android Studio 50:00 | Preview | ||
Creating Android Virtual Device 25:00 | |||
Executing Project on Android Screen (AVD) 6:00 | |||
Executing Project on Android Screen (ADB) 10:00 | |||
Knowing the IDE - Quiz | |||
Debugging Android Apps (Logcat, Toast, Breakoints, Error Resolving) 13:00 | |||
Introduction to XML 14:00 | |||
Knowing the Development Process - Quiz | |||
Assignment (1 pages) | |||
Knowing the Development Process Notes (5 pages) | |||
Java Components | |||
Introduction 14:00 | |||
Setting up Java in Command Prompt 9:00 | |||
Making First Java Class in Notepad Hello World 10:00 | |||
Packages and Classes 9:00 | |||
Java Components Quiz 1 | |||
Datatypes 6:00 | |||
Variables 8:00 | |||
Methods 16:00 | |||
Java Components Quiz 2 | |||
Encapsulation 6:00 | |||
Keywords and Identifiers 8:00 | |||
Method Overloading 7:00 | |||
Inheritance 17:00 | |||
Method Overriding 13:00 | |||
Objects and calling 8:00 | |||
Constructors 6:00 | |||
Java Components Quiz 3 | |||
Interface and Implements 4:00 | |||
Use of this, static & final 16:00 | |||
Conditional Statements 8:00 | |||
If, If Else & If Else Else If 9:00 | |||
Loops 7:00 | |||
For and For each loop 8:00 | |||
While and Do While 6:00 | |||
String Operations 13:00 | |||
Java Components Quiz 4 | |||
Assignment (1 pages) | |||
Java Components Notes (31 pages) | |||
Getting into Designing UI | |||
How to design in Android apps (Layouts) writing code in XML 64:00 | |||
How to design in Android apps (Views) 36:00 | |||
Introduction to XML - Quiz | |||
How to design in Android apps using Drag and Drop 34:00 | |||
Getting into Designing UI - Quiz 1 | |||
Getting into Designing UI - Quiz 2 | |||
Assignment (1 pages) | |||
Getting into Designing UI Notes (7 pages) | |||
Making First App | |||
Android Architecture 13:00 | |||
Android Components 10:00 | |||
Activity Lifecycle 10:00 | |||
Making First Android App (BMI) 45:00 | |||
Android Architecture - Quiz | |||
Making Tic-Tac-Toe 55:00 | |||
Intent Passing 21:00 | |||
Bundle Passing 18:00 | |||
Making First App - Quiz 1 | |||
Making a Splash Screen 19:00 | |||
Making First App - Quiz 2 | |||
Assignment (1 pages) | |||
Making First App Notes (11 pages) | |||
Enhancing UI | |||
Animation 48:00 | |||
Custom Animation in Android (Lottie Animation) 21:00 | |||
Animations in Android - Quiz | |||
Card View 17:00 | |||
ListView, Spinner & AutoCompleteTextView 37:00 | |||
Styles and Themes 14:00 | |||
Making App Universal (Screen Compatible) 10:00 | |||
Enhancing UI - Quiz 1 | |||
Recycler View 63:00 | |||
Adding/Deleting and Updating Items in Recycler View 36:00 | |||
Animating the items of Recycler View 15:00 | |||
Recycler View - Quiz | |||
Creating your own toolbar(Custom Toolbar) 48:00 | |||
Creating your own Drawable(Custom Drawable) 51:00 | |||
Enhancing UI - Quiz 1 | |||
Enhancing UI - Quiz 2 | |||
Assignment (1 pages) | |||
Enhancing UI Notes (13 pages) | |||
Notifications | |||
Toast 13:00 | |||
Customizing Toast 30:00 | Preview | ||
Notifications - Quiz 1 | |||
Using Logs and LogCat in Android 18:00 | |||
Showing AlertDialog Box on UI 37:00 | |||
Customizing Dialog 19:00 | |||
Notifications - Quiz 2 | |||
Status Bar Notifications 32:00 | |||
Customizing Notifications 26:00 | |||
Notifications - Quiz 3 | |||
Notifications - Quiz 4 | |||
Assignment (1 pages) | |||
Notifications Notes (11 pages) | |||
Implicit Calls | |||
Making Calls, Dailing, Sending Mails & Sharing App Installation Link 38:00 | |||
Implicit Calls - Quiz | |||
Assignment (1 pages) | |||
Implicit Calls - Notes (3 pages) | |||
Fragments | |||
Introducing Fragments and FrameLayout 58:00 | |||
Tab Layout 33:00 | |||
Fragments - Quiz 1 | |||
Bottom Navigation View 37:00 | |||
Navigation Drawer 45:00 | |||
Managing Fragment Backstack 10:00 | |||
Data Passing in Fragment 14:00 | |||
Fragments - Quiz 2 | |||
Assignment (1 pages) | |||
Fragments - Notes (8 pages) | |||
Location Based Services and Google Maps | |||
Implementing Google Maps 43:00 | |||
Map Overlays 12:00 | |||
Geocoder 21:00 | |||
Assignment (1 pages) | |||
Location Based Services and Google Maps Notes (4 pages) | |||
Web Services and WebView | |||
Introduction to Dynamic Apps 16:00 | |||
Receiving HTTP Response (JSON) 8:00 | |||
What is JSON Response 14:00 | |||
JSON - Quiz | |||
Parsing Response 27:00 | |||
Parsing Response (POST API) 30:00 | |||
WebView 21:00 | |||
Web Services and WebView - Quiz 1 | |||
Web Services and WebView - Quiz 2 | |||
Assignment (1 pages) | |||
Web Services and WebView Notes (9 pages) | |||
Data Storage | |||
Bundle Passing 18:00 | |||
Shared Preferences 33:00 | |||
Database 3:00 | |||
Introducing SQLite 9:00 | |||
SQLiteOpenHelper and creating a database 22:00 | |||
Sqlite - Quiz | |||
Opening and closing a database 4:00 | |||
Inserting Data in database (Insert) 10:00 | |||
Fetching Data from a database (Select) 15:00 | |||
Working with cursors updates, and deletes 24:00 | |||
Database - Quiz | |||
Database Room Library (Daily Expense App) 32:00 | |||
Data Storage - Quiz | |||
Assignment (1 pages) | |||
Data Storage Notes (7 pages) | |||
Camera & Gallery | |||
Taking pictures 2:00 | |||
Getting Pictures from Camera to App 19:00 | |||
Getting Pictures from Gallery to App 11:00 | |||
Camera & Gallery - Quiz | |||
Assignment (1 pages) | |||
Camera & Gallery Notes (2 pages) | |||
Multimedia in Android | |||
Media Player (Audio) 30:00 | |||
Video View 19:00 | |||
Multimedia in Android - Quiz | |||
Multimedia in Android Notes (5 pages) | |||
Sensors | |||
How Sensors work? 17:00 | |||
Accelerometer Sensor and its Applications 13:00 | |||
Proximity Sensor and its Applications 8:00 | |||
Ambient Light Sensor and its Applications 16:00 | |||
Sensors - Quiz 1 | |||
Assignment (1 pages) | |||
Sensors Notes (3 pages) | |||
Services and Receivers | |||
Overview of services and its Lifecycle in Android 17:00 | |||
Implementing a Service 13:00 | |||
Alarm Manager 27:00 | |||
Sending & Receiving messages 23:00 | |||
Services and Receivers - Quiz 1 | |||
Services and Receivers - Quiz 2 | |||
Assignment (1 pages) | |||
Services and Receivers Notes (4 pages) | |||
Getting along with Kotlin | |||
Introduction to Kotlin 13:00 | |||
Setting up Kotlin 7:00 | |||
Classes in Kotlin 3:00 | |||
First Program in Kotlin (Hello World!) 3:00 | |||
Variable & Types 4:00 | |||
Val & Var 5:00 | |||
Methods in Kotlin 7:00 | |||
Conditions 7:00 | |||
Lists 20:00 | |||
For and For Each Loop 7:00 | |||
While and Do While 4:00 | |||
Kotlin Basics- Quiz 1 | |||
Triple,Pair 8:00 | |||
Learning the Basic Syntax 11:00 | |||
Intent Passing 5:00 | |||
Recycler View 10:00 | |||
Maps 4:00 | |||
Assignment - Module 17 (1 pages) | |||
Getting along with Kotlin Notes (3 pages) | |||
Kotlin Basics- Quiz 2 | |||
Taste of Firebase | |||
Introduction 15:00 | |||
Creating a Firebase Project on Console 17:00 | |||
Cloud Messaging (Push Notifications) 23:00 | |||
Firestore (Realtime Database) 18:00 | |||
Taste of Firebase - Quiz | |||
App Monetisation Method | |||
What are Ads? 13:00 | |||
Implementing Banner Ads 12:00 | |||
Implementing Interstitial Ads 12:00 | |||
App Monetisation Method - Quiz | |||
Assignment (1 pages) | |||
App Monetisation Method Notes (6 pages) | |||
Module 20 - Releasing the App | |||
What is Playstore ? 7:00 | |||
Creating Signed .apk 11:00 | |||
Going live on Playstore 31:00 | |||
Module 21 - Tyding Up | |||
Building a Calculator App in Kotlin 17:00 | |||
Our First Kotlin App (BMI) 29:00 | |||
Making a TicTacToe in Kotlin 16:00 | |||
Building a Notes App (using Room Library) 34:00 | |||
Using Runtime Permission DialogBox for Risky Permission 22:00 |
After successful purchase, this item would be added to your courses.
You can access your courses in the following ways :